Dealerships

Car key fobs have become a vital part of modern vehicles, providing convenience and security for drivers. They can be used to lock and unlock a car, set off the car's security alarm and even start it with the correct key used to start the ignition. If these devices are damaged or destroyed they need to be replaced or reprogrammed to ensure that they function as intended. The cost of reprogramming devices is often very high, especially when the procedure is carried out by dealers. Knowing the cost can help you decide if you should go to an auto locksmith or a dealership for this service.

The type of key you have will have a major impact on the cost of reprogramming your device. There are a myriad of types of key fobs. These range from the basic primary keys to more sophisticated transponder models. Each model has its own unique features and programming needs which can impact the total cost. Certain keys may require specialized programming that is not accessible to the general public. This requires an appointment with an agent.

Many people assume that they can save money by reprogramming their key fob themselves, and in some instances, this is the case. Certain fobs, based on the model can be programmed online or by following the instructions found in the owner's manual for the vehicle. This eliminates the need to visit a dealer. However for more advanced fobs that have been integrated into the vehicle's key or that require a specific FOBIK chip it is not always feasible.

Some large auto parts retailers like AutoZone and others, sell replacement remotes with instructions on how to self-program them. However, this is not the case for most vehicles. They need to be connected to the vehicle's computer with specific equipment to ensure the fob works properly. programming car key can be risky since any error could alter the information stored on the fob's key. It's best to leave the job to professionals.

Auto Locksmiths

The majority of modern cars are equipped with key fobs that can unlock and lock doors as well as arm or disarm an alarm system, and start the engine of the car. While these devices are useful, they can be problematic. The cost of replacing the key fob which is damaged or has lost its battery could be high. Additionally, the process of installing a new device often requires the help of a specialist to program it correctly. Auto locksmiths provide car key programming services near me at a fraction of the price dealers charge.

A locksmith who is a professional and offers a replacement car key fob service might have specialized tools that can be used with all types of vehicles. Some professionals can reprogram an old key fob or keyless remote for an entirely different vehicle. It's not always possible depending on the year, model, and make.

A locksmith's contact prior to going to a dealership to replace your car key fob is always a good idea. This is because locksmiths are usually able to provide a better service and will cost less than the dealership. A professional locksmith will have the tools and knowledge to install a new key fob, program it into your vehicle, and offer a warranty for their work.

Certain manufacturers restrict dealers from selling and programming key fobs from aftermarket manufacturers. The aftermarket key fobs have a different digital encryption from the original equipment keyfob, which could cause problems with your car's safety system. Some dealers told us they could program key fobs for aftermarket use if the owner understood the dangers.

A professional locksmith can use the special tool known as a programmable transponder to program a new key fob for your vehicle. The tool is able to detect the unique serial numbers and other information from your car's fob. Then, it will match the data to the correct key code in the computer system of your car.

Hacking can be carried out on key fobs, regardless of the age of your car or older. Criminals employ specialized devices that amplify signals to fool your car and key fob into thinking that they are closer than they are. This can cause the key fob to open or activate your engine, which can result in theft. You can purchase gadgets like faraday bags that block these signals and help prevent them from working.
